Why work with an out of network therapist?
Paying out of pocket for therapy allows privacy benefits - no diagnosis on your medical record or notes with vulnerable information submitted to your insurance company. Insurance benefits often limit the number of sessions, and you may have a high deductible which would lead you to paying fees out of pocket anyways. A lot of plans have great out-of-network benefits where your insurance company will reimburse your session fee.
